4. Don’t Overlook the Finish

The finish of your Italian brass hardware can completely change the look and feel of a space. Here are some popular options:

  • Polished Brass: This finish has a high shine and reflects light beautifully, making it perfect for adding a touch of glamour.
  • Brushed Brass: With a matte finish, brushed brass offers a more subdued, contemporary look.
  • Antique Brass: This finish has a vintage, weathered appearance that adds character and depth to a space.

When choosing a finish, consider the overall aesthetic of the room. Polished brass works well in formal settings, while brushed or antique brass is ideal for more relaxed, lived-in spaces.

9. Invest in Quality

When it comes to Italian brass hardware, quality is key. Cheap imitations might save you money upfront, but they won’t stand the test of time. Authentic Italian brass is crafted to last, with a level of detail and durability that’s hard to beat.

Here’s what to look for:

  • Weight: High-quality brass feels solid and substantial in your hand.
  • Finish: The finish should be smooth and even, with no visible flaws.
  • Craftsmanship: Look for pieces that are well-constructed, with no loose parts or rough edges.

Investing in quality hardware might cost more initially, but it will pay off in the long run.

10. Maintain Your Brass Hardware

To keep your Italian brass hardware looking its best, regular maintenance is essential. Brass is a durable material, but it can tarnish over time if not properly cared for.

Here’s how to keep it shining:

  • Clean Regularly: Use a soft cloth to wipe down your brass hardware and remove dust and fingerprints.
  • Polish as Needed: For polished brass, use a brass cleaner to restore its shine. For brushed or antique finishes, a gentle wipe with a damp cloth is usually sufficient.
  •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Steer clear of abrasive cleaners, which can damage the finish.

With a little care, your Italian brass hardware will continue to look stunning for years to come.
